packages: mcelog/mcelog-FHS.patch, mcelog/mcelog.logrotate, mcelog/mcelog.s...
gotar
gotar at pld-linux.org
Mon Feb 1 22:44:24 CET 2010
Author: gotar Date: Mon Feb 1 21:44:24 2010 GMT
Module: packages Tag: HEAD
---- Log message:
- upgraded to 1.0pre3
---- Files affected:
packages/mcelog:
mcelog-FHS.patch (1.2 -> 1.3) , mcelog.logrotate (1.1 -> 1.2) , mcelog.spec (1.12 -> 1.13) , mcelog-DESTDIR.patch (1.3 -> NONE) (REMOVED)
---- Diffs:
================================================================
Index: packages/mcelog/mcelog-FHS.patch
diff -u packages/mcelog/mcelog-FHS.patch:1.2 packages/mcelog/mcelog-FHS.patch:1.3
--- packages/mcelog/mcelog-FHS.patch:1.2 Mon Apr 6 11:59:30 2009
+++ packages/mcelog/mcelog-FHS.patch Mon Feb 1 22:44:18 2010
@@ -1,11 +1,11 @@
---- mcelog-0.8pre/mcelog.c~ 2007-01-09 13:57:26.000000000 +0200
-+++ mcelog-0.8pre/mcelog.c 2008-10-08 19:16:07.114831791 +0300
-@@ -37,7 +37,7 @@
- enum cputype cpu = CPU_GENERIC;
+--- mcelog-1.0pre3/paths.h.orig 2010-01-21 03:36:52.000000000 +0100
++++ mcelog-1.0pre3/paths.h 2010-02-01 22:38:22.000000000 +0100
+@@ -1,7 +1,7 @@
+ #define PREFIX ""
- char *logfn = "/dev/mcelog";
--char *dimm_db_fn = "/var/lib/memory-errors";
-+char *dimm_db_fn = "/var/lib/misc/memory-errors";
+ #define LOG_DEV_FILENAME "/dev/mcelog"
+-#define DIMM_DB_FILENAME PREFIX "/var/lib/memory-errors"
++#define DIMM_DB_FILENAME PREFIX "/var/lib/misc/memory-errors"
+ #define CONFIG_FILENAME PREFIX "/etc/mcelog/mcelog.conf"
- int use_syslog;
- int do_dmi;
+ #define SOCKET_PATH "/var/run/mcelog-client"
================================================================
Index: packages/mcelog/mcelog.logrotate
diff -u packages/mcelog/mcelog.logrotate:1.1 packages/mcelog/mcelog.logrotate:1.2
--- packages/mcelog/mcelog.logrotate:1.1 Mon May 8 14:27:37 2006
+++ packages/mcelog/mcelog.logrotate Mon Feb 1 22:44:18 2010
@@ -9,4 +9,3 @@
chmod 644 /var/log/mcelog
endscript
}
-
================================================================
Index: packages/mcelog/mcelog.spec
diff -u packages/mcelog/mcelog.spec:1.12 packages/mcelog/mcelog.spec:1.13
--- packages/mcelog/mcelog.spec:1.12 Tue Jun 16 15:32:52 2009
+++ packages/mcelog/mcelog.spec Mon Feb 1 22:44:18 2010
@@ -1,17 +1,15 @@
# $Revision$, $Date$
-%define subver pre
-%define rel 4
+%define subver pre3
Summary: x86-64 Machine Check Exceptions collector and decoder
Summary(pl.UTF-8): Narzędzie do zbierania i dekodowania wyjątków MCE na platformie x86-64
Name: mcelog
-Version: 0.8
-Release: 0.%{subver}.%{rel}
+Version: 1.0
+Release: 0.%{subver}
License: GPL v2
Group: Applications/System
-Source0: ftp://ftp.x86-64.org/pub/linux/tools/mcelog/%{name}-%{version}%{subver}.tar.gz
-# Source0-md5: 97fba9e248f23f12d562b92e90ed77fc
+Source0: http://www.kernel.org/pub/linux/utils/cpu/mce/%{name}-%{version}%{subver}.tar.gz
+# Source0-md5: b42f2214de6f4feb992556149edc67fa
Source1: %{name}.logrotate
-Patch0: %{name}-DESTDIR.patch
Patch1: %{name}-FHS.patch
Requires: crondaemon
Requires: logrotate
@@ -50,7 +48,6 @@
%prep
%setup -q -n %{name}-%{version}%{subver}
-%patch0 -p1
%patch1 -p1
%build
@@ -60,26 +57,30 @@
%install
rm -rf $RPM_BUILD_ROOT
-install -d $RPM_BUILD_ROOT{%{_sbindir},%{_mandir}/man8,/etc/{logrotate.d,cron.d},/var/log}
+install -d $RPM_BUILD_ROOT{/etc/{cron,logrotate}.d,/var/log,%{statdir}}
+
%{__make} install \
- DESTDIR=$RPM_BUILD_ROOT
+ prefix=$RPM_BUILD_ROOT/%{_prefix} \
+ etcprefix=$RPM_BUILD_ROOT
+
cat <<'EOF' > $RPM_BUILD_ROOT/etc/cron.d/%{name}
0 * * * * root %{_sbindir}/mcelog --ignorenodev --filter >> /var/log/mcelog
EOF
+
install %{SOURCE1} $RPM_BUILD_ROOT/etc/logrotate.d/%{name}
-install -d $RPM_BUILD_ROOT%{statdir}
-touch $RPM_BUILD_ROOT%{statdir}/memory-errors
+:> $RPM_BUILD_ROOT%{statdir}/memory-errors
%clean
rm -rf $RPM_BUILD_ROOT
%files
%defattr(644,root,root,755)
-%doc CHANGES README TODO
+%doc CHANGES README TODO TODO-diskdb mce.pdf
%attr(755,root,root) %{_sbindir}/mcelog
%attr(640,root,root) /etc/cron.d/mcelog
%config(noreplace) %verify(not md5 mtime size) /etc/logrotate.d/mcelog
+%config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/%{name}
%attr(640,root,root) %ghost %{statdir}/memory-errors
%{_mandir}/man8/mcelog.8*
@@ -89,6 +90,9 @@
All persons listed below can be reached at <cvs_login>@pld-linux.org
$Log$
+Revision 1.13 2010/02/01 21:44:18 gotar
+- upgraded to 1.0pre3
+
Revision 1.12 2009/06/16 13:32:52 arekm
- release 4
================================================================
---- CVS-web:
http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/mcelog/mcelog-FHS.patch?r1=1.2&r2=1.3&f=u
http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/mcelog/mcelog.logrotate?r1=1.1&r2=1.2&f=u
http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/mcelog/mcelog.spec?r1=1.12&r2=1.13&f=u
More information about the pld-cvs-commit
mailing list